What is a Leveraged Buyout (LBO)?

A Leveraged Buyout (LBO) occurs when investors acquire a company through the combination of their equity funds and substantial debt financing. The acquired business assets together with its cash flow serve as security to back the obtained debt.

Private equity firms execute this strategy by using borrowed funds to increase potential investment returns instead of funding the entire acquisition with investor equity. The acquired company’s successful performance enables equity investors to generate significantly higher IRR (Internal Rate of Return) and MOIC (Multiple on Invested Capital) than an all-equity acquisition would produce.

The method enables investors to purchase big companies through smaller initial investments while keeping full control of the business operations.

Real-World Examples of LBOs

Leveraged buyouts are not just theory they’ve shaped some of the most famous deals in business history:

  • KKR’s Acquisition of RJR Nabisco (1989): One of the largest and most iconic LBOs of all time, valued at nearly $25 billion. It highlighted both the opportunities and controversies around high levels of debt financing.
  • Blackstone’s Buyout of Hilton Hotels (2007): Purchased for $26 billion, Hilton became one of the most successful LBOs ever. After streamlining operations and riding a post-crisis travel boom, Blackstone reportedly made around $14 billion in profit when Hilton went public.
  • Dell’s Take-Private Transaction (2013): Michael Dell, alongside Silver Lake Partners, used a leveraged buyout to take Dell Technologies private. This move gave the company flexibility to restructure without the short-term pressure of public markets.

These examples demonstrate how LBOs can vary across industries but share the same foundation: smart use of debt and operational improvements to drive strong returns.

Expertise: Key Components of an LBO Model

An LBO model may look like a spreadsheet filled with numbers, but underneath, it’s a story of how an acquisition will play out financially. To build a reliable model, several key components need to be included and carefully linked together.

Assumptions & Key Inputs

Every LBO model starts with assumptions and the foundation for the entire analysis. These assumptions set the stage for purchase price, financing, and operating performance.

Some of the most important inputs include:

  • Purchase Price / Entry Multiple: How much is being paid for the company, usually expressed as a multiple of EBITDA.
  • Financing Mix: The ratio of debt to equity used to fund the transaction.
  • Operating Assumptions: Revenue growth, EBITDA margins, working capital needs, and capital expenditures.
  • Exit Assumptions: Expected holding period (often 5–7 years) and exit multiple.

Getting these inputs right is critical, because even small changes can have a big impact on projected returns.

Sources & Uses of Funds

The Sources & Uses schedule is the deal’s financial blueprint. It explains exactly where the money is coming from (sources) and how it will be spent (uses).

  • Sources: Debt (senior, mezzanine, high-yield bonds), equity contributions from investors, and sometimes seller financing or management rollover equity.
  • Uses: Purchase price for the company, repayment of existing debt, transaction fees, and financing fees.

This section ensures that the deal is properly funded and that every dollar has a clear purpose.

Operating Projections & Cash Flow

At the heart of the LBO model are operating projections and a forward-looking view of how the company will perform during the investment period.

Key items include:

  • Revenue Growth Forecasts: Based on market conditions and company strategy.
  • EBITDA & Profit Margins: A measure of profitability that drives cash flow.
  • Capital Expenditures (CapEx): Investments required to maintain or grow the business.
  • Working Capital Changes: Adjustments for accounts receivable, inventory, and payables.

These projections determine the company’s ability to generate free cash flow, which is crucial for servicing debt and building equity value.

Debt Schedule & Repayment Structure

Because leverage is central to an LBO, a detailed debt schedule is one of the most important parts of the model.

It tracks:

  • Opening Balances: The total debt borrowed at the start.
  • Interest Expense: Calculated based on the outstanding balance and loan terms.
  • Mandatory Repayments: Required principal repayments (often senior debt).
  • Optional Repayments (Cash Sweep): Extra repayments if the company generates surplus cash.
  • Closing Balances: Updated after each period.

A strong debt schedule shows whether the company can comfortably handle its obligations or if the deal is too risky.

Exit Valuation & Return Metrics (IRR, MOIC)

No private equity firm invests forever. That’s why the exit valuation is a key component of the LBO model.

  • Exit Enterprise Value: Based on the assumed exit multiple applied to EBITDA in the final year.
  • Equity Value: Calculated by subtracting remaining debt from enterprise value.
  • IRR (Internal Rate of Return): Measures the annualized return on investor equity.
  • MOIC (Multiple on Invested Capital): Shows how many times investors have multiplied their original investment.

For most private equity deals, a target IRR of 20%–25% and MOIC of 2x–3x are considered attractive benchmarks.

Step-by-Step LBO Model Process

While each firm may customize its approach, most LBO models follow a standard flow:

  1. Set Entry Assumptions
    • Define purchase price and entry multiple.
    • Decide on financing mix (debt vs. equity).
    • Establish operating assumptions like revenue growth and margins.
  2. Build Sources & Uses of Funds
    • Show how the acquisition is funded (sources).
    • Allocate where money goes: purchase price, debt repayment, fees (uses).
  3. Project Operating Performance
    • Forecast revenue, EBITDA, and net income.
    • Factor in CapEx and working capital changes to estimate free cash flow.
  4. Construct the Debt Schedule
    • Layer in senior debt, subordinated debt, or mezzanine loans.
    • Apply interest payments, mandatory repayments, and optional cash sweeps.
  5. Calculate Free Cash Flow & Equity Value
    • Track cash flow available after debt service.
    • Measure how quickly debt reduces over the holding period.
  6. Model the Exit
    • Apply an assumed exit multiple to EBITDA in the final year.
    • Subtract net debt to calculate equity value.
  7. Analyze Returns
    • Measure IRR (Internal Rate of Return) and MOIC (Multiple on Invested Capital).
    • Stress-test results with sensitivity tables.

This step-by-step process ensures the model reflects both financial reality and deal strategy.

Common Mistakes in LBO Modeling

Even experienced analysts make mistakes when building LBO models. Some of the most frequent errors include:

  • Unrealistic Assumptions: Overestimating revenue growth or underestimating expenses leads to inflated returns.
  • Ignoring Working Capital Needs: Many forget that businesses need cash tied up in inventory, receivables, and payables.
  • Incomplete Debt Schedules: Missing a repayment line or interest calculation can throw off the entire model.
  • Overleveraging: Using too much debt looks good on paper but may be unmanageable in real-world scenarios.
  • No Sensitivity Analysis: Deals rarely go exactly as planned without testing downside scenarios, investors risk major surprises.

Avoiding these mistakes is crucial for maintaining trust and credibility with lenders, investors, and clients.

LBO vs. DCF & Other Valuation Models

While LBO models are powerful, they’re not the only tool in finance. Understanding how they differ from other valuation models highlights their unique purpose:

  • LBO Model: Focuses on returns to equity investors when significant debt financing is used. It’s investor-oriented and return-driven.
  • DCF Model (Discounted Cash Flow): Values a business based on the present value of projected future cash flows, without necessarily including leverage. It’s more of an intrinsic valuation tool.
  • Merger Model (M&A): Examines synergies and accretion/dilution in mergers and acquisitions, focusing on combined company performance.
  • Trading & Transaction Comps: Compare valuation multiples from similar companies or past deals to determine a market-driven value.

Ensuring Accuracy in Financial Modeling

Accuracy is non-negotiable in LBO modeling. Even small mistakes like miscalculating interest expenses or forgetting a working capital adjustment can completely distort projected returns.

Best practices to ensure accuracy include:

  • Linking Assumptions Carefully: Avoid hardcoding numbers; link calculations to assumptions for easy updates.
  • Cross-Checking Calculations: Use balancing checks, such as ensuring sources equal uses or confirming the balance sheet ties out.
  • Scenario Testing: Stress-test the model under multiple conditions to ensure it works across optimistic, base, and downside cases.
  • Peer Reviews: Having another analyst or team member audit the model can catch errors before the deal reaches investors.

By showing diligence and precision, analysts not only create more reliable outputs but also reinforce trust in the investment process.

While both models estimate a company’s value, they approach it differently:

  • DCF (Discounted Cash Flow): Values a company based on its future cash flows, discounted to present value. It focuses on intrinsic value, independent of financing structure.

  • LBO Model: Focuses on returns to investors using high leverage (debt). The emphasis is not just on the company’s value but on whether debt repayment and investor returns are achievable within a defined holding period.

So, while a DCF helps understand “what a company is worth,” an LBO evaluates “whether buying it with debt makes financial sense.”

LBOs carry certain risks due to their reliance on leverage. The most common include:

  • Debt Burden: If the company underperforms, it may struggle to meet interest and principal repayments.

  • Market Conditions: Changes in interest rates or credit availability can affect financing costs.

  • Operational Risks: Poor management, supply chain issues, or competition can erode profitability.

  • Exit Risks: If market multiples decline, selling the company at a strong valuation becomes difficult.

These risks highlight why detailed modeling and sensitivity analysis are crucial in LBO deals.

Leverage amplifies returns in an LBO because investors use borrowed money to finance a large portion of the purchase price. If the company performs well:

  • Debt gets repaid using operating cash flows.

  • Equity investors achieve higher returns because they invested less upfront capital.

For example, if a deal is financed with 70% debt and 30% equity, even modest business growth can yield outsized equity returns. However, the same leverage also magnifies losses if performance declines, which makes careful modeling essential.
